Juan delivers bunker sand in a truck. The truck bed is 3 yards long, 2 yards wide and 1 yard high. Bunker sand costs $79 per cub

ic yard. What is the cost of the total amount of bunker sand that Juan's truck bed can hold?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Simora [160]3 years ago
7 0
Base x Width x Height.
3 x 2 x 1 = 6*79 = $474

A local hamburger shop sold a combined total of 575 hamburgers and cheeseburgers on Sunday. There were 75 fewer cheeseburgers so
lara31 [8.8K]

Answer:

250 Hamburgers

Step-by-step explanation:

575 is total

Hamburger is x

Cheesburgers is (x-75) as it is 75 less than the number of hamburgers

x + (x-75) = 575

2x -75 = 575

2x = 500

x = 250
